Description

Leidos is looking for our next TS/SCIcleared DevOps Software Engineer to join a highenergy team building and deploying a cuttingedge technology stack in support of the DIANMEC (National Media Exploitation Center) DOMEX Technology Platform (DTP). This role is part of a 10year program supporting the DOMEX Data Discovery Platform (D3P) Modernization effort, where you'll contribute to missioncritical capabilities alongside a collaborative, innovative, and growthoriented team.

While the majority of work is performed onsite at our customer location in Bethesda, MD, we offer a flexible schedule and occasional opportunities for remote work.

What You'll Do

As a DevOps Software Engineer, you'll help design, deploy, and maintain a fullstack, containerized microservices architecture. You'll also support systems administration, installation, configuration, and the broader adoption of DevOps best practices across crossfunctional engineering teams. In this fastpaced environment, you'll collaborate closely with systems engineering, architecture, development, security, operations, and integration teams.

You will work with a multidisciplinary group of developers, integrators, and system administrators to:

  • Deploy, triage, and maintain a production bigdata pipeline built on Kubernetes, Elasticsearch, and Kafka

  • Enhance and maintain CI/CD pipelines and DevOps automation to accelerate development and improve reliability

  • Design and support scalable, redundant infrastructure across physical and virtual environments

  • Use Helm to configure Kubernetes deployments for new features and evolving requirements

  • Partner with Systems Engineers to architect solutions for new capabilities

  • Contribute technical input to engineering documentation, diagrams, and models

  • Participate in Agile release planning, scrums, design sessions, bug triage, and related team activities

What You Bring

You're enthusiastic, collaborative, and comfortable working with teammates across a range of technical backgrounds. You also meet the following q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ree in Engineering, Computer Science, Systems Engineering, or related field (or equivalent experience) with 8+ years of relevant experience; 6+ years with a Master's

  • Active TS/SCI clearance and ability to obtain/maintain a TS/SCI with Polygraph

  • Strong Linux proficiency

  • Handson experience with containers and Kubernetes

  • Experience with CI/CD orchestration and GitLab

  • Familiarity with Elasticsearch, Logstash, and Kibana

  • Demonstrated success working in crossfunctional engineering environments

Bonus Points

You'll stand out even more if you bring:

  • Experience operating systems at scale

  • Knowledge of Agile methodologies

  • Development experience (Bash, PowerShell, SALT, Python, Groovy, Java, etc.)

  • Experience supporting enterprise or production systems

  • Familiarity with:

    • Kafka or other messaging systems (AMQP, JMS)

    • Kubernetes monitoring tools (Prometheus, Grafana)

    • GPUbased Kubernetes

    • SALT for deployment automation

    • Helm / Helmfile

    • Nexus

Securing Your Data

Beware of fake employment opportunities using Leidos' name. Leidos will never ask you to provide payment-related information during any part of the employment application process (i.e., ask you for money), nor will Leidos ever advance money as part of the hiring process (i.e., send you a check or money order before doing any work). Further, Leidos will only communicate with you through emails that are generated by the Leidos.com automated system - never from free commercial services (e.g., Gmail, Yahoo, Hotmail) or via WhatsApp, Telegram, etc. If you received an email purporting to be from Leidos that asks for payment-related information or any other personal information (e.g., about you or your previous employer), and you are concerned about its legitimacy, please make us aware immediately by emailing us at LeidosCareersFraud@leidos.com.

If you believe you are the victim of a scam, contact your local law enforcement and report the incident to the U.S. Federal Trade Commission.
